How Bathrooms Are Rebuilt and Finished

Remodeling begins with demolition in North Franklin, where old tile, fixtures, vanities, and flooring are removed and subfloors are inspected for water damage or rot. Your builder installs waterproof membranes on walls and floors before setting new tile, ensuring moisture does not penetrate behind surfaces and cause mold or structural issues.

After tile is set and grouted, you will see new vanities secured to walls, faucets and drains connected without leaks, toilets mounted with wax-free seals, and shower doors or curtain rods installed at the correct height. Ventilation fans will exhaust humid air directly outside rather than into the attic, which reduces condensation and prevents mold growth. The finished bathroom will have clean grout lines, level tile, and fixtures that function reliably without dripping or running.

Each remodel includes caulking around tubs, showers, and sinks to seal joints against water intrusion, and mirrors are mounted securely with appropriate backing. The work does not include window replacement, structural framing changes, or heated flooring unless discussed in advance. You are left with a fully operational bathroom that handles daily use without moisture problems or maintenance issues.

How long does a bathroom remodel take?
Most bathroom remodels in North Franklin take two to four weeks from demolition to final cleanup, depending on the size of the room, complexity of tile work, and whether plumbing or electrical systems need upgrading. Custom vanities or specialty tile may extend the timeline.
What tile materials work best in bathrooms?
Porcelain and ceramic tile resist moisture, clean easily, and hold up to daily use without cracking or staining. Large-format tiles reduce grout lines and make cleaning faster, while smaller mosaic tiles provide slip resistance on shower floors.
Why is waterproofing important during a remodel?
Water that seeps behind tile or through grout lines damages drywall, rots framing, and creates conditions for mold growth. Waterproof membranes installed before tile prevent moisture from reaching structural materials and keep your bathroom dry long-term.
What is a shower-to-tub conversion?
A conversion replaces an existing bathtub with a walk-in shower or vice versa, depending on your needs. Walk-in showers improve accessibility and are easier to clean, while tubs are necessary for bathing young children or soaking.
How does improved ventilation help a bathroom?
A properly sized and vented exhaust fan removes humid air quickly, which reduces condensation on mirrors, walls, and ceilings. This prevents mold growth, keeps paint from peeling, and makes the bathroom more comfortable after showers.
